Introduction: The Mt. Gox Collapse Defined

The Mt. Gox collapse refers to the catastrophic failure of the Tokyo-based cryptocurrency exchange Mt. Gox in 2014. At its peak, Mt. Gox handled over 70% of all Bitcoin transactions worldwide, making its downfall an unprecedented event that sent shockwaves through the nascent cryptocurrency market. The exchange filed for bankruptcy after revealing the loss of approximately 850,000 Bitcoins, valued at hundreds of millions of dollars at the time. This incident remains a stark reminder of the inherent risks associated with centralized exchanges and the critical importance of robust security protocols and sound management in the digital asset space.

What Was Mt. Gox? A Brief History

Originally launched in 2007 by Jed McCaleb as an online exchange for "Magic: The Gathering Online" trading cards (hence "Magic: The Gathering Online eXchange"), the platform was repurposed in 2010 to facilitate Bitcoin trading. In 2011, McCaleb sold Mt. Gox to Mark Karpelès, under whose leadership it rapidly ascended to become the dominant force in the Bitcoin market. Its early success was driven by the burgeoning interest in Bitcoin, but this rapid growth also masked significant operational and security vulnerabilities that would eventually lead to its demise.

The Mechanics of Failure: A Timeline of Vulnerabilities

The collapse of Mt. Gox was not a sudden event but rather the culmination of years of systemic weaknesses, security breaches, and mismanagement.

Early Warnings and Systemic Flaws

Even before its ultimate failure, Mt. Gox experienced significant security incidents. In June 2011, a hacker gained access to the exchange's database, manipulating Bitcoin prices and stealing approximately 25,000 BTC from user accounts. While this incident was a clear red flag, the underlying security architecture was not fundamentally overhauled. A critical flaw identified later was the exchange's practice of keeping nearly 90% of its customer funds in "hot wallets" – online storage directly connected to the internet – a stark contrast to industry best practices of using "cold storage" (offline wallets) for the vast majority of assets.

Another technical issue that exacerbated Mt. Gox's problems was Bitcoin's "transaction malleability." This protocol quirk allowed attackers to modify the unique transaction ID of a Bitcoin transaction before it was confirmed on the blockchain, without altering the transaction's content. While not a direct cause of the theft, this vulnerability created confusion within Mt. Gox's poorly designed systems, making it difficult to track transactions and potentially allowing attackers to trick the exchange into releasing funds multiple times.

The Unraveling: Withdrawal Issues and Loss of Trust

By late 2013 and early 2014, users began reporting severe and prolonged delays in withdrawing their Bitcoins from Mt. Gox. These issues were initially attributed to banking problems and transaction malleability, but as delays persisted and rumors of insolvency circulated, user confidence plummeted. The exchange's opaque communication and lack of transparency only fueled speculation and panic. On February 7, 2014, Mt. Gox officially halted all Bitcoin withdrawals, citing transaction malleability as the primary reason. This move effectively trapped customer funds on the exchange.

The Catastrophic Hack and Bankruptcy

The situation rapidly deteriorated. On February 24, 2014, Mt. Gox suspended all trading, shut down its website, and removed its presence from social media. Days later, the company filed for bankruptcy protection in Japan, followed by a similar filing in the United States. The official declaration stated that approximately 850,000 Bitcoins were missing, including 100,000 of the company's own Bitcoins and 750,000 belonging to customers. While 200,000 BTC were later "found" in an old cold wallet, the vast majority remained unaccounted for, attributed to a combination of external hacks, internal theft, and gross mismanagement.

Far-Reaching Consequences: Market Impact and Regulatory Response

The Mt. Gox collapse had profound and lasting effects on the cryptocurrency market and its subsequent development.

Bitcoin Price Volatility and Investor Confidence

The immediate aftermath saw a significant drop in Bitcoin's price. Between February and March 2014, the value of Bitcoin plummeted by approximately 36%, reflecting a massive loss of investor confidence and a widespread fear that such an event could recur. This period marked one of Bitcoin's most severe bear markets, demonstrating how critical infrastructure failures could destabilize the entire ecosystem.

Shaping Industry Security and Regulation

The incident served as a harsh wake-up call for the entire crypto industry. It directly spurred a paradigm shift in how exchanges approached security. Modern, reputable exchanges now routinely implement multi-factor authentication, rigorous Know Your Customer (KYC) procedures, and, most importantly, store the vast majority of customer assets in secure cold storage, often distributed geographically. The collapse also prompted increased scrutiny from global regulators, leading to the development of the first formal cryptocurrency regulations, particularly in Japan, which sought to prevent similar catastrophes and protect consumers.

Lessons for Traders and Investors: Mitigating Exchange Risk

The Mt. Gox saga offers invaluable lessons for anyone engaging with cryptocurrency markets.

Prioritizing Exchange Security and Due Diligence

The most critical lesson is the paramount importance of security. Traders and investors must conduct thorough due diligence on any exchange they use. This includes researching its security history, auditing practices, and storage methods (e.g., cold storage percentages). Diversifying holdings across multiple reputable exchanges and, crucially, moving significant assets off exchanges into personal hardware or software wallets (where you control the private keys) are essential risk management strategies.

Understanding Counterparty and Liquidity Risks

Mt. Gox highlighted the severe counterparty risk inherent in centralized exchanges – the risk that the entity holding your assets fails or acts maliciously. When an exchange collapses, your funds are at the mercy of bankruptcy proceedings, which can be lengthy and may not result in full recovery. Furthermore, during times of crisis, liquidity can vanish, making it impossible to sell assets even if they are technically accessible.

Common Mistakes to Avoid

  • Over-reliance on a single exchange: Spreading assets across multiple platforms reduces exposure to any single point of failure.
  • Storing large amounts on exchanges: Exchanges are targets; personal wallets offer greater control and security for long-term holdings.
  • Ignoring red flags: Withdrawal delays, opaque communication, or rumors of insolvency should prompt immediate action.
  • Neglecting personal security: Strong, unique passwords and two-factor authentication are non-negotiable for all crypto accounts.

Practical Example: The Mt. Gox Legacy

The Mt. Gox collapse stands as the quintessential example of centralized exchange failure. Its legacy is not just one of loss, but also of profound change. The prolonged legal battle for creditor restitution, which has stretched on for nearly a decade, with repayments still ongoing (and even including Bitcoin Cash allocations from the 2017 fork), serves as a stark reminder of the complexities and delays involved when an exchange goes bankrupt. This ongoing process underscores the long-term consequences for affected individuals and the importance of self-custody.
